Introduction
Creamy Prawn Linguine is a delicious dish that combines the rich flavors of creamy sauce with the delightful taste of prawns, all tossed with perfectly cooked linguine. This recipe is not only easy to prepare but also delivers a restaurant-quality meal that can impress your family and friends.
Detailed Ingredients with measures
Pasta Linguine – 300g
Prawns (peeled and deveined) – 250g
Garlic (minced) – 2 cloves
Fresh parsley (chopped) – a handful
Double cream – 150ml
Lemon juice – from 1 lemon
Olive oil – 2 tablespoons
Salt – to taste
Black pepper – to taste
Grated Parmesan cheese – for serving
Prep Time
Prep time for this dish is approximately 10 minutes.
Cook Time, Total Time, Yield
Cook time is around 15 minutes, leading to a total time of 25 minutes. This recipe yields about 2-3 servings, making it perfect for a cozy dinner or a lovely meal with guests.
Detailed Directions and Instructions
Step 1: Prepare the Ingredients
Start by gathering all necessary ingredients: linguine pasta, prawns, garlic, fresh chili, parsley, cream, white wine, and lemon.
Step 2: Cook the Pasta
In a large pot of boiling salted water, cook the linguine according to the package instructions until al dente. Reserve a cup of the cooking water before draining the pasta.
Step 3: Sauté the Aromatics
In a large frying pan, heat some olive oil over medium heat. Add minced garlic and chopped fresh chili, cooking for about a minute until fragrant.
Step 4: Add the Prawns
Add the prawns to the pan and cook for 3-4 minutes until they turn pink and are cooked through.
Step 5: Incorporate the White Wine
Pour in the white wine and allow it to bubble and reduce for a couple of minutes, which will enhance the flavors.
Step 6: Stir in the Cream
Pour in the cream, stirring well to combine. Let it simmer gently for a few minutes to thicken slightly.
Step 7: Combine Pasta and Sauce
Add the drained linguine to the frying pan, tossing it with the sauce. If it appears too thick, add a little reserved pasta water until the desired consistency is reached.
Step 8: Finish with Lemon and Parsley
Zest and juice a lemon over the pasta, along with chopped parsley. Toss everything together for a fresh flavor boost.
Step 9: Serve
Plate the creamy prawn linguine and garnish with additional parsley and lemon wedges, if desired. Enjoy your meal!
Notes
Ingredient Variations
Feel free to substitute prawns with another type of seafood, such as scallops or chopped fish.
Vegetarian Option
For a vegetarian version, consider using seasonal vegetables or mushrooms instead of prawns, and replace the cream with a plant-based alternative.
Storage Instructions
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to two days. Reheat gently on the stove with a splash of water or stock to maintain creaminess.
Spice Level
Adjust the amount of fresh chili according to your preferred spice level, or omit it entirely for a milder dish.
Wine Selection
Choose a dry white wine, such as Sauvignon Blanc or Pinot Grigio, for the best flavor infusion into the sauce.
